What Makes a Hotel Eco-Friendly?
Eco-friendly hotels implement various practices to promote sustainability. Key features often include energy-efficient lighting, water-saving fixtures, and waste reduction programs. Many of these hotels also use biodegradable products and source food locally to ensure minimal environmental impact. By choosing to stay at such hotels, you’re supporting their efforts in fighting climate change.
Some hotels even go a step further by incorporating renewable energy sources like solar panels or wind turbines. These initiatives not only benefit the environment but also provide a unique and educational experience for guests. Look for certifications like LEED or Green Key when booking your stay.

Explore Miami's Natural Beauty
Miami offers a wealth of natural attractions that cater to eco-conscious travelers. From the Everglades National Park to Biscayne Bay, there are plenty of opportunities to enjoy the great outdoors responsibly. Consider guided tours that emphasize conservation and education about local ecosystems.
Choose Eco-Friendly Activities
In addition to staying at green hotels, participate in activities that promote sustainability. Miami offers a range of eco-friendly tours and excursions, such as kayaking through mangroves or snorkeling in protected marine areas. These activities not only provide a fun experience but also support conservation efforts.
